Why Choose Energy-Efficient Windows? The Benefits Explained

Energy-efficient windows have become a cornerstone of modern home improvement, showcasing a blend of functionality, aesthetics, and sustainability. They are meticulously designed to reduce energy consumption significantly while enhancing the comfort and appeal of your home. At the heart of their appeal lies the dual benefit of maintaining an optimal indoor climate and reducing energy bills, which can be substantial over time. By minimizing heat loss during winter and preventing heat gain in the summer, these windows help maintain an even temperature throughout your home, contributing to a more comfortable living environment.

Moreover, energy-efficient windows often employ advanced glazing techniques, including low-emissivity (low-E) glass, which reflects heat back into the room during winter whilst keeping it out during warmer months. This technology not only increases thermal efficiency but also provides UV protection, safeguarding your furniture, carpets, and artwork from fading. Furthermore, these windows come in various styles and designs, allowing homeowners to maintain their desired architectural aesthetic while upgrading their home’s energy performance.

Types of Energy-Efficient Windows: Finding Your Perfect Match

When it comes to selecting energy-efficient windows, several types are available, each offering unique benefits based on your specific needs and preferences. The most common types include double-pane, triple-pane, and low-E glass windows. Double-pane windows feature two layers of glass with a gas-filled space in between, typically argon or krypton, acting as an additional insulating barrier. This design significantly reduces heat transfer, making them a popular choice among homeowners looking to improve their windows’ energy efficiency.

Triple-pane windows, while more expensive, provide an even higher level of insulation due to the additional glass layer and gas fill. These windows are particularly beneficial for homeowners in regions with extreme weather conditions, as they retain heat during winter and cool air during summer far more effectively than their single or double-pane counterparts.

Low-E glass is another remarkable option that enhances energy efficiency by reflecting interior temperatures back into the room, preventing outside temperatures from affecting indoor comfort. Some windows also come with specialized coatings that improve light transmission without compromising thermal performance. Homeowners should assess their climate, budget, and aesthetic preferences carefully when choosing the right type of energy-efficient windows for their homes.

Furthermore, it’s essential to consider the frame material as well. Common materials like vinyl, wood, aluminum, and fiberglass each offer unique benefits that can impact overall energy efficiency. For instance, vinyl frames provide excellent insulation and require minimal maintenance, while wooden frames can offer superior aesthetic qualities and may be the choice for historic homes. Understanding the interplay between window type, glass technology, and frame material is crucial to maximizing your investment in energy-efficient windows.

Cost vs. Savings: Understanding the Long-Term Financial Benefits

The initial cost of installing energy-efficient windows can appear daunting to many homeowners. However, considering the long-term savings they offer is crucial in justifying this investment. While the price of high-quality energy-efficient windows can range from $300 to $1,000 or more per window, the energy savings you’ll experience over the years can quickly offset this cost.

According to the U.S. Department of Energy, homeowners can save an average of $126 to $465 annually on their energy bills with energy-efficient windows, depending on the region and efficiency of the original windows being replaced. These savings accumulate over time, making the investment in new windows not only practical but financially savvy. Additionally, many utility companies offer rebates and incentives for installing energy-efficient windows, further reducing your upfront costs.

Assessing Your Current Windows: Signs It’s Time for an Upgrade

Before embarking on the journey of upgrading your windows, it’s essential to assess your current window situation thoroughly. Several indicators can signal that it’s time for a change. One primary sign is noticeable drafts around the windows, which can cause fluctuating indoor temperatures and lead to increased energy bills. Additionally, you should inspect for condensation between the panes of glass, as this can indicate a failure in the seal, rendering the window less effective at insulating your home.

Another vital consideration is the age of your windows. Older windows, particularly single-pane varieties, might not meet current energy standards, which can lead to inefficiencies. Beyond functionality, aesthetic aspects should also not be overlooked—if your windows exhibit significant chipping, peeling, or other visual imperfections, it may not only detract from your property’s curb appeal but can also signify underlying issues that compromise performance.

Lastly, if you are considering upgrading your home to meet specific energy efficiency standards or if it is part of a comprehensive renovation project, an upgrade becomes even more imperative. Evaluating multiple factors— from performance and aesthetics to the age of your current solutions—will help you make an informed decision on upgrading to energy-efficient windows.

Choosing the Right Time for Installation: Seasons, Weather, and More

Timing your window installation can significantly impact the process and the final result. The ideal timing often hinges on seasonal weather patterns. Spring and early fall are typically considered the best times for installation due to milder temperatures, making it comfortable for both the installers and your household. Additionally, during these seasons, the demand for window replacements might be lower than during peak summer months, enabling you to secure better pricing and availability on your preferred window products.

Weather conditions play a critical role as well; extreme heat or cold can affect the sealing process and installation timing. Rainy or windy conditions can delay installation projects or even impact the quality of the installation itself. Therefore, it’s prudent to consult with your installation team regarding weather patterns in your area and set a schedule that accommodates a smooth installation process.

The Installation Process: What to Expect

A Step-by-Step Overview of Window Installation

The installation of energy-efficient windows generally consists of several systematic steps, ensuring the process is both seamless and effective. Firstly, the installation team will conduct a thorough assessment of your home’s existing windows and take precise measurements. This initial step is critical, as accurate measurements dictate how well the new windows will fit and perform.

Following the assessment, the installation begins with the careful removal of old windows. It is essential to do this without damaging the surrounding wall structure or interior finishes. Next, the team will prepare the window openings by cleaning and inspecting the frames for any damage, sealing gaps, and ensuring there are no mold or rot issues present. This preparation is vital for ensuring the integrity of the new windows and their ability to maintain energy efficiency.

Once the window frames are ready, the new energy-efficient windows will be positioned and secured in place. Precision is essential during this phase to guarantee a proper fit that minimizes air leakage and optimizes insulation. After the windows are set, any necessary insulation will be installed around the frames, followed by caulking and weather stripping to further enhance performance.

Finally, the installation team will conduct a performance test to check for any drafts or leaks, ensuring that the windows are properly sealed and ready for use. A quality installation will typically take a day or so per window, depending on various factors, such as the number of windows being replaced and the complexity of the job.

Post-Installation Tips: Ensuring Your Windows Perform Their Best

Following the installation of your energy-efficient windows, there are several essential steps to ensure they continue performing at their best. Begin with an inspection of the newly installed windows; check for any signs of drafts or moisture and address anything that appears amiss immediately. Proper sealing and installation are paramount to the overall effectiveness of your new windows.

Routine maintenance plays an essential role in prolonging the lifespan and efficiency of your windows. Regularly clean the window glass and frames using gentle cleaning solutions, and inspect the weather-stripping for signs of wear. If the sealing around the windows begins to crack or peel, replacing it promptly will prevent air leaks and maintain thermal performance. This routine upkeep supports the initial investment while contributing to continued energy efficiency in your home.

Additionally, consider conducting semi-annual performance tests to assess how your windows are performing. This could include checking their insulation properties and verifying that no air infiltration occurs. Proper care will not only ensure maximum energy efficiency but can also lead to an extended lifespan for your windows and a more comfortable home environment.

Energy-Efficient Practices to Pair with Your New Windows

To truly maximize the benefits of your new energy-efficient windows, consider incorporating complementary energy-efficient practices throughout your home. For instance, using energy-efficient window treatments, such as cellular shades or blackout curtains, can enhance insulation and reduce heat loss or gain.

Furthermore, embrace a holistic approach to energy efficiency by implementing smart home technologies, such as programmable thermostats, which optimize heating and cooling schedules based on your family’s routines. Integrating energy-efficient lighting, appliances, and HVAC systems can also complement your window upgrades, resulting in a comprehensive approach to energy savings.

Additionally, exploring renewable energy options, such as solar panels, can further decrease your home’s reliance on conventional energy sources, leading to additional savings on utility bills. FAQ

Question: Can I install energy-efficient windows myself? – While it may be tempting to undertake a DIY project, energy-efficient window installation is complex and requires professional expertise to ensure proper sealing, insulation, and compliance with building codes.

Question: How long do energy-efficient windows typically last? – Energy-efficient windows can last between 20 to 40 years or more, depending on the materials used, quality of installation, and maintenance practices followed.

Question: Do energy-efficient windows come with warranties? – Yes, most manufacturers offer warranties that cover defects in materials and workmanship for a specified period, typically ranging from 5 to 20 years, providing added peace of mind for homeowners.

Question: How can I find financial assistance for window installation? – Homeowners can check with local utility companies, state programs, and federal tax incentives for rebates, grants, or low-interest loans that support energy-efficient home improvements.

Question: Is there a particular type of glass most recommended for energy-efficient windows? – Low-E glass is highly recommended due to its ability to reflect infrared light and reduce heat transfer, keeping homes cooler in summer and warmer in winter.

Question: Can I customize the appearance of energy-efficient windows to match my home’s style? – Yes, energy-efficient windows are available in various styles, colors, and materials, allowing homeowners to customize their look while enhancing energy performance.

Question: Are there any specific maintenance requirements for energy-efficient windows? – Regular cleaning, inspecting weather stripping, and sealing repairs are key maintenance steps to ensure optimal performance and longevity of energy-efficient windows.

Question: Can energy-efficient windows reduce noise as well as energy costs? – Yes, energy-efficient windows, particularly those with multiple panes and specialized glazing, can significantly reduce outside noise, enhancing indoor comfort and tranquility.
